Mid Cap Copper Stocks at a Glance
Copper companies explore, mine, smelt, and refine copper ore and products. Long mine lead times keep supply inelastic, so prices swing with global construction and industrial demand — and electrification makes copper a structural beneficiary of the energy transition.
